E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
XCTF杂项解题思路
【LeetCode刷题笔记】字符串
844.比较含退格的字符串
解题思路
:1.双指针,从后往前遍历,设两个指针i和j分别指向字符串s和t的末尾,只要i>=0&&j>=0就循环比较:<
川峰
·
2023-12-22 20:13
LeetCode刷题笔记
leetcode
数据结构与算法
字符串
对撞指针
快慢指针
计数数组
回文串
【LeetCode刷题笔记】数学
50.Pow(x,n)
解题思路
:1.绝对值+快速幂+迭代,由于题目n可能是系统最小值,因此使用n的绝对值。如果n是系统最小值,先让
川峰
·
2023-12-22 20:43
LeetCode刷题笔记
LeetCode
数据结构与算法
数学
【LeetCode刷题笔记】前缀树
208.实现Trie(前缀树)
解题思路
:1.前缀树Map实现,使用一个Map来存储每个字符对应的若干子节点,在构造函数中初始化根节点root为当前对象实例,在插入
川峰
·
2023-12-22 20:39
LeetCode刷题笔记
LeetCode
前缀树
字符串
LeetCode 24. 两两交换链表中的节点
LC24.两两交换链表中的节点2020.10.13第一次解答:菜鸡用迭代怎么都搞不出来,有幸在评论区发现https://lyl0724.github.io/2020/01/25/1/这篇博客后豁然开朗
解题思路
使用递归实现
浪矢清
·
2023-12-22 19:31
LeetCode个人记
链表
leetcode
java
算法
LC24.两两交换链表中的节点
题目查看题目
解题思路
虽然用了辅助指针,但主要还是双指针的思路。主要思想如下:当head为null或者链表中只有一个元素的时候,直接返回head即可。
始终在仰望大佬
·
2023-12-22 19:00
LeetCode
leetcode
链表
双指针
1005. K 次取反后最大化的数组和 && 增强for循环(foreach循环)遍历数组
1005.K次取反后最大化的数组和原题链接:完成情况:
解题思路
:参考代码:_1005K次取反后最大化的数组和_1005K次取反后最大化的数组和_简洁写法错误经验吸取增强for循环(foreach循环)遍历数组原题链接
Wzideng
·
2023-12-22 18:43
java学习
算法知识
#
LeetCode题解
java
list
数据结构
链表
算法
_55跳跃游戏 && _45跳跃游戏II
_55跳跃游戏&&_45跳跃游戏II原题链接:完成情况:
解题思路
:_55跳跃游戏_45跳跃游戏II参考代码:_55跳跃游戏_45跳跃游戏II_从覆盖范围角度考虑_45跳跃游戏II错误经验吸取原题链接:_
Wzideng
·
2023-12-22 18:43
java学习
算法知识
#
LeetCode题解
数据结构
算法
java
链表
list
git
杂项
-----------------------------------------------------------1.Failedtoconnecttogithub.comport443连接超时-----------------------------------------------------------$gitconfig--global--https.sslVerify"false"
hjjdebug
·
2023-12-22 17:51
#
svn和git
git
力扣题目学习笔记(OC + Swift)17. 电话号码的字母组合
关键字:所有组合模式识别:搜索算法
解题思路
:自顶向下的递归实现深度搜索定义子问题在当前递归层结合子问题解决原问题SwiftfuncletterCombinations(_digits:String)->
Jarlen John
·
2023-12-22 16:28
数据结构与算法
leetcode
学习
笔记
面试题17:打印从1到最大的n位数
比如输入3,则打印出1、2、3一直到最大的3位数999.
解题思路
这是一道看起来很简单但一点都不简单的题目。应注意到题目对n的范围没有做限制,当输入n很大时,求最大的n位数是不是用整型或长整型会溢出?
潘雪雯
·
2023-12-22 15:04
【LeetCode - 666】路径和 IV
文章目录1、题目描述2、
解题思路
3、解题代码1、题目描述2、
解题思路
如果题目给定的是二叉树的根节点,那么直接dfs即可。 现在题目给的是用整数来表示的节点。
学哥斌
·
2023-12-22 15:20
LeetCode刷题记录
leetcode
java
安全基础~信息搜集2
文章目录知识补充30余种加密编码&
杂项
CTF信息收集资产&框架违法源码搜索CDN绕过站点搭建分析WAF知识补充因此,当你用御剑扫描时:若扫描域名,扫描的实际是网站根目录下的一个文件夹;若扫描IP,扫描的实际是网站的根目录
`流年づ
·
2023-12-22 09:08
安全学习
安全
专注思维:只有专注,才能同时做好很多事(d235)
《学会成长》共读作者:粥左罗专注和兼顾都是很好的
解题思路
,各有优势。但好像这两者又互相冲突,专注了就没法兼顾,兼顾了就没法专注,我们应该怎么办?你有没有想过,这两者是有可能和谐共处的呢?
书海拾慧
·
2023-12-22 03:57
马蹄集第33周
题目一无重复字串的最长字串
解题思路
:双指针:设置两个指针L,R,分别指向traget的开头和结尾,并且使用一个哈希表存储char到int的映射,然后R++,当出现重复的字符,那么要在对应的哈希表里面--
杜阿福
·
2023-12-22 02:24
算法
【每日一题】力扣106.从中序与后序遍历序列构造二叉树
例如,给出中序遍历inorder=[9,3,15,20,7]后序遍历postorder=[9,15,7,20,3]返回如下的二叉树:3/\920/\157
解题思路
&代码实现二叉树遍历已知先序、中序结果构造二叉树
Josvin
·
2023-12-22 01:18
每日一题
二叉树
算法
数据结构
leetcode
剑指Offer——将二叉树打印成多行
解题思路
先从层次遍历开始,借用队列结构,会依次把下一层的结点加入队列中。那么如何判断一行打印完了?实际上一次操作的过程中,我们会涉及到当前层结点的出队,和下一层结点的入队。
Mereder
·
2023-12-22 00:19
两个单链表相交的一系列问题
解题思路
把原问题分成两个子问题:1.判断链表是否有环2.判断两个链表是否相交子问
Ramsey16k
·
2023-12-22 00:46
Leetcode 1005 K 次取反后最大化的数组和
解题思路
:采用贪心的思路来解题。则需要定义局部最优解和全局最优解。全局最优解:最终的数组和最大则我们需要保证绝对值大的数尽可能为正,绝对值最小的数为负。
庄园特聘拆椅狂魔
·
2023-12-21 23:19
刷题训练营
leetcode
算法
数据结构
Leetcode 134 加油站
解题思路
:当前站剩余油量累计-下一站耗油0,那么:必然存在位置0->位置1,从位置1开往下一节点剩余油0。所以:当开往下一节点剩余油<0时,将当前节点的下一个节点作
庄园特聘拆椅狂魔
·
2023-12-21 23:19
刷题训练营
leetcode
算法
数据结构
Leetcode 93 复原 IP 地址
解题思路
:如何在合适的位置添加小数点。其和切割字符串以满足某种要求的题目是类似的。这一类的题都可以用回溯的方法解决。约束条件则对应在合适的地方做
庄园特聘拆椅狂魔
·
2023-12-21 23:49
刷题训练营
算法
leetcode
数据结构
Leetcode 135 分发糖果
解题思路
:采用贪心的方法来
庄园特聘拆椅狂魔
·
2023-12-21 23:49
刷题训练营
leetcode
算法
数据结构
Leetcode 45 跳跃游戏 II
解题思路
:如上面的例子所示:两种方式都能跳到末尾,但是最小步数是2.要用贪心法解题,就要明确什么是局部最优,什么是全局最优。这道题里,全
庄园特聘拆椅狂魔
·
2023-12-21 23:17
刷题训练营
leetcode
算法
数据结构
178.【2023年华为OD机试真题(C卷)】CPU算力分配(实现Java&Python&C++&&JS)
本专栏所有题目均包含优质
解题思路
,高质量解题代码,详细代码讲解,助你深入学习,深度掌握!
一见已难忘
·
2023-12-21 23:08
java
华为od
c语言
python
javascript
c++
华为OD机试真题
c语言:输入行数,打印杨辉三角|练习题
一、题目输入行数,打印杨辉三角如图:二、
解题思路
1、先完成后面的三角形2、打印前面的空格3、把空格和三角形合并打印即所求图形三、代码截图【带注释】四、源代码【带注释】#include//思路://先完成后面的三角形
木木爱编程
·
2023-12-21 21:13
c语言|练习题
c语言
算法
数据结构
开发语言
华为OD机试 - 连续出牌数量 - 深度优先搜索dfs算法(Java 2023 B卷 200分)
目录专栏导读一、题目描述二、输入描述三、输出描述1、输入2、输出3、说明四、
解题思路
1、题目解读2、具体步骤五、Java算法源码六、效果展示1、输入2、输出3、说明华为OD机试2023B卷题库疯狂收录中
哪 吒
·
2023-12-21 19:46
搬砖工逆袭Java架构师
算法
华为od
深度优先
七日集训
学习
程序人生
华为OD机试 - 区间交集 - 深度优先搜索dfs算法(滥用)(Java 2023 B卷 200分)
目录专栏导读一、题目描述二、输入描述三、输出描述备注用例1、输入2、输出3、说明四、
解题思路
1、核心思路:2、具体步骤五、Java算法源码再重新读一遍题目,看看能否优化一下~解题步骤也简化了很多。
哪 吒
·
2023-12-21 19:14
搬砖工逆袭Java架构师
算法
华为od
深度优先
七日集训
学习
LeetCode0110: 平衡二叉树
解题思路
:递归算法的关键是要
bluescorpio
·
2023-12-21 15:29
leetcode题目22: 括号生成(java)
示例输入:n=3输出:["((()))","(()())","(())()","()(())","()()()"]
解题思路
利用二叉树的遍历。
castlet
·
2023-12-21 11:18
leetcode题解(含
解题思路
)(持续更新中)
数组&字符串&双指针两数之和给定一个整数数组nums和一个整数目标值target,请你在该数组中找出和为目标值target的那两个整数,并返回它们的数组下标思路:使用哈希表,把数组中的值依次存入map,存入时判断map中是否有target-num[i],若有就把两个下标存入新数组返回classSolution{publicint[]twoSum(int[]nums,inttarget){Mapma
白 山 茶
·
2023-12-21 09:34
leetcode
java
面试
LeetCode:第57场双周赛记录
LeetCode:第57场双周赛记录1941.检查是否所有字符出现次数相同题目描述解法1942.最小未被占据椅子的编号题目描述解法1943.描述绘画结果题目描述解法1944.队列中可以看到的人数题目描述
解题思路
yawen_2016
·
2023-12-21 09:32
java
算法
3D渲染慢,买显卡还是用云渲染更合适?
3D渲染速度慢通常带来以下痛点:工作效率低下:慢的渲染速度会导致工作效率下降,特别是在大型复
杂项
目中,渲染时间可能需要数小时甚至数天。项目进度滞后:由于慢的渲染速度,项目可能
3DCAT实时渲染云
·
2023-12-21 09:52
3DCAT新闻资讯
3d
实时渲染
图形渲染
面试题57(1):和为s的数字
例如,输入数组{1,2,4,7,11,15}和数字15.由于4+11=15,因此输出4和11
解题思路
定义两个指针,第一个指针指向数组的第一个(最小的)数字1,第二个指针指向数组的最后一个(最大的)数字15
潘雪雯
·
2023-12-21 04:23
【牛客网华为机试】HJ12 字符串反转
示例1输入:abcd输出:dcba
解题思路
(1)将输入字符串反转(2)输出反转后的字符串>>>"abcd"[::-1]'dcba'代码print(input()[::-1])
202xxx
·
2023-12-21 00:23
求两个整数中的较大者(用函数实现)
解题思路
:用一个函数来实现两个整数的较大者。
白桃乌龙来一打
·
2023-12-20 19:48
C常见例题
c语言
LeetCode 每日一题 2023/12/4-2023/12/10
记录了初步
解题思路
以及本地实现代码;并不一定为最优也希望大家能一起探讨一起进步目录12/41038.从二叉搜索树到更大和树12/52477.到达首都的最少油耗12/62646.最小化旅行的价格总和12/
alphaTao
·
2023-12-20 19:04
Exercise
leetcode
算法
LeetCode 每日一题 2021/9/13-2021/9/19
记录了初步
解题思路
以及本地实现代码;并不一定为最优也希望大家能一起探讨一起进步目录9/13447.NumberofBoomerangs回旋镖的数量9/14524.LongestWordinDictionarythroughDeleting
alphaTao
·
2023-12-20 19:34
Exercise
leetcode
算法
LeetCode 每日一题 2023/11/20-2023/11/26
记录了初步
解题思路
以及本地实现代码;并不一定为最优也希望大家能一起探讨一起进步目录11/2053.最大子数组和11/212216.美化数组的最少删除数11/222304.网格中的最小路径代价11/231410
alphaTao
·
2023-12-20 19:34
Exercise
leetcode
算法
LeetCode 每日一题 2023/11/27-2023/12/3
记录了初步
解题思路
以及本地实现代码;并不一定为最优也希望大家能一起探讨一起进步目录11/27907.子数组的最小值之和11/281670.设计前中后队列11/292336.无限集中的最小数字11/301657
alphaTao
·
2023-12-20 19:34
Exercise
leetcode
python
算法
LeetCode 每日一题 2023/12/11-2023/12/17
记录了初步
解题思路
以及本地实现代码;并不一定为最优也希望大家能一起探讨一起进步目录12/111631.最小体力消耗路径12/122454.下一个更大元素IV12/132697.字典序最小回文串12/142132
alphaTao
·
2023-12-20 19:30
Exercise
leetcode
算法
上岸算法 I LeetCode Weekly Contest 222解题报告
No.1卡车上的最大单元数
解题思路
优先使用容量大的箱子即可。
上岸算法
·
2023-12-20 15:20
171.【2023年华为OD机试真题(C卷)】寻找身高相近的小朋友(排序算法实现Java&Python&C++&JS)
本专栏所有题目均包含优质
解题思路
,高质量解题代码,详细代码讲解,助你深入学习,深度掌握!
一见已难忘
·
2023-12-20 15:05
java
华为od
c语言
寻找身高相近的小朋友
华为OD机试真题
筛选法求0到100之间的素数
目录1问题:2代码:3运行结果:4
解题思路
:5总结:1问题:筛选法又称筛法,具体做法是:先把N个自然数按次序排列起来。1不是质数,也不是合数,要划去。
杰克尼
·
2023-12-20 15:03
算法
二维数组的输入和输出
1
解题思路
:二维数组定义的一般形式为:类型说明符数组名[常量表达式][常量表达式];二维数组则需要循环语句的嵌套2代码如下:拿走不谢#includeintmain(){inta[3][4];inti,j
杰克尼
·
2023-12-20 15:32
c语言
算法
数据结构
LeetCode 7. 整数反转
解题思路
把int整数转换成字符串,然后进行逆序输出,针对负号和超出数值范围进行额外判断cl
freesan44
·
2023-12-20 14:15
【LeetCode】每日一题 2023_12_19 寻找峰值 II(二分)
文章目录刷题前唠嗑题目:寻找峰值II题目描述代码与
解题思路
刷题前唠嗑LeetCode?启动!!!
戊子仲秋
·
2023-12-20 14:39
LeetCode
每日一题
leetcode
算法
职场和发展
【LeetCode】每日一题 2023_12_20 判别首字母缩略词(简单题)
文章目录刷题前唠嗑题目:判别首字母缩略词题目描述代码与
解题思路
结语刷题前唠嗑LeetCode?启动!!!
戊子仲秋
·
2023-12-20 14:39
LeetCode
每日一题
leetcode
算法
职场和发展
【LeetCode】每日一题 2023_12_17 使用最小花费爬楼梯(动态规划)
文章目录刷题前唠嗑题目:使用最小花费爬楼梯题目描述代码与
解题思路
刷题前唠嗑考完六级,我终于又回来了,LeetCode每日一题?启动!!!
戊子仲秋
·
2023-12-20 14:08
LeetCode
每日一题
leetcode
动态规划
算法
【LeetCode】每日一题 2023_12_18 寻找峰值 (二分)
文章目录刷题前唠嗑题目:寻找峰值题目描述代码与
解题思路
结语刷题前唠嗑LeetCode?启动!!!
戊子仲秋
·
2023-12-20 14:37
LeetCode
每日一题
leetcode
算法
职场和发展
ARTS第四周20200613
解题思路
:把数组自身处理成bitpublicintfirstMissingPositive(int[]nums)
chenyuan21177
·
2023-12-20 11:09
【LeetCode刷题笔记】位运算
231.2的幂
解题思路
:1.除法,不断循环判断,如果能被2整除,就不断除以2,直到不能被2整除为止,最后结果如果是1,说明可以除尽,是2的幂次方,否则就不是。特判:
川峰
·
2023-12-20 10:11
LeetCode刷题笔记
leetcode
算法与数据结构
位运算
二进制位
上一页
36
37
38
39
40
41
42
43
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他